Administrative Lab DirectorOverview
We are seeking an experiencedLaboratory Directorto lead and oversee all aspects of laboratory operations atChilton Medical Center. The Director will be responsible for ensuring the delivery of high-quality, compliant, and efficient laboratory services across multiple sections, including Core Lab, Blood Bank, Phlebotomy, and Point of Care. This role offers a unique opportunity for an accomplished leader with strong operational, strategic, and fiscal management experience within a hospital or multi-hospital system.
Administrative Lab DirectorKey Responsibilities
- Provide overall direction and management of daily operations across all laboratory sections.
- Ensure compliance with CAP, CLIA, and other regulatory standards.
- Oversee and mentor Section Supervisors, Lead Technologists, and Technologists to promote a culture of quality and accountability.
- Lead quality management initiatives, workflow optimization, and productivity improvements.
- Develop and manage departmental budgets; coordinate objectives and goals for optimal operational and fiscal performance.
- Maintain strong communication with the Leadership Team, Pathologists, and other departments to ensure seamless collaboration.
- Address and resolve operational challenges, complaints, and performance issues in coordination with leadership.
- Initiate and implement new laboratory procedures, technologies, and process enhancements.
- Conduct regular staff meetings and ensure consistent, effective communication throughout the department.
- Support professional development through coaching, training, and performance evaluations.
- Serve as an administrative and technical resource for the laboratory team, providing consultation as needed via phone or electronic means.
Administrative Lab DirectorRequired Qualifications
- Must meetcurrent CAP requirementsfor a laboratory supervisor.
- Bachelor’s degreein Medical Technology, or in a physical, chemical, biological, or clinical laboratory science.
- ASCP certification (or equivalent)required.
- Minimum of
- six (6) years of clinical laboratory experience , including
- three (3) years in a supervisory role .
- Proven experience leading laboratory operations within ahospital or multi-hospital system.
- Demonstrated expertise inbudget development and managementfor large teams or departments.
- C-suite interaction experiencerequired.
- Strong background inquality management,
- strategic planning , and
- team leadership .
- Excellent communication,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.
Administrative Lab DirectorPreferred Qualifications
- Master’s degree(MBA or MHA) strongly preferred.
- Prior experience as anAdministrative Lab Directorwithin a large healthcare organization.
- Familiarity with high-complexity testing environments (CLIA/CAP).
